22 lines
499 B
JavaScript
22 lines
499 B
JavaScript
// @ts-check
|
|
import { createConfigForNuxt } from '@nuxt/eslint-config'
|
|
|
|
export default createConfigForNuxt({
|
|
features: {
|
|
stylistic: true,
|
|
typescript: true,
|
|
},
|
|
}).override('nuxt/vue/rules', {
|
|
rules: {
|
|
'vue/first-attribute-linebreak': 'off',
|
|
'vue/no-v-html': 'off',
|
|
'vue/html-closing-bracket-newline': 'off',
|
|
'vue/html-self-closing': 'off',
|
|
'vue/max-attributes-per-line': 'off',
|
|
},
|
|
}).override('nuxt/stylistic', {
|
|
rules: {
|
|
'no-useless-escape': 'off',
|
|
},
|
|
})
|